Description
The private rear garden enjoys a sunny westerly orientation, creating the perfect setting for outdoor dining, entertaining, or simply relaxing in peaceful surroundings. Upstairs, there are two generously proportioned bedrooms, each featuring built-in wardrobes, along with a well-appointed family bathroom. Further enhancing the appeal of this fine home are double glazed PVC windows and gas-fired central heating, ensuring comfort and energy efficiency throughout the seasons.
Ideally located, Ashfield is just a short stroll from the vibrant town centre of Balbriggan, with an excellent selection of shops, cafés, schools, and local amenities all within easy reach. The property is also less than a ten-minute walk from Balbriggan Train Station, the picturesque beach, and harbour, making commuting and coastal living effortlessly accessible. ,4 Ashfield Drive offers the perfect balance of suburban tranquillity and modern convenience in one of North County Dublin’s most established residential settings.

Rooms
Kitchen 2.12m x 3.89m with range of modern shaker wooden kitchen units & worktops, cooker, oven & extractor fan, plumbed for washing machine and dishwasher. Tiled splashback & flooring.
Living Room 3.97m x 4.37m with laminate wood flooring, feature fireplace with open fire, sliding room to rear garden, understairs store room.
Bedroom One 3.97m x 4.05m with carpet flooring, built in wardrobes
Bedroom Two 2.1m x 4.21m with Lyno flooring
Bathroom 1.8m x 2.74m with modern tiling and wc, whb, bath, tiled floor and bath with shower overhead.

About the Area
Balbriggan is a large seaside town in the northern part of Fingal in County Dublin. The 2011 census population was 19,960, as the area experienced a population boom in the early part of the 2000s due to the demand for housing within the wider Dublin region. The area is served by a number of amenities, from schools to supermarkets, and locals have access to an abundance of leisure facilities - including Balbriggan Strand.
